Summary
CVE-2025-21769 is a vulnerability affecting the Linux kernel. Specifically, in the "ptp: vmclock" subsystem, the inclusion of the ".owner" field in vmclock_miscdev_fops was found to be missing. The absence of this field allows the module to be unloaded even when /dev/vmclock0 is open, resulting in an "oops" error. This issue has since been addressed in the latest kernel updates.
